    DISH Local Channel Listings for OTA

    I currently am on 61.5, 110, and 119. I only get my locals for Peoria, IL in SD from 110 since I don't have line of sight to 129 to get them in HD (tree problem).

    I currently have an OTA antenna hooked up to my 722k which I get my locals in HD from.

    If I swap to the EA setup (1000.4) will I still be able to have the listings for my OTA signal show up? Not just a blank generic listing on my grid?

    You MUST subscribe to local channels to be able to get the guide data for the OTA channels on a Dish receiver. Dish does it this way on purpose. Sorry.
